How Atomization Works
Atomization typically involves converting a liquid or solid material into fine particles using methods such as spraying, grinding, or chemical processes. By breaking down the material into tiny particles, the surface area increases significantly, allowing for better reactivity and enhanced properties.
The Applications of Atomized Materials
Atomized materials are used in numerous industries for various purposes. For example, atomized powders are commonly used in additive manufacturing processes like 3D printing. These powders enable the creation of complex and precise parts with excellent mechanical properties.
The Advantages of Atomized Powders
Atomized powders offer several advantages over traditional materials. Due to their fine particle size and increased surface area, atomized powders exhibit improved strength, density, and flow properties. Additionally, these powders can be customized to meet specific requirements, making them ideal for advanced manufacturing processes.
